Photography by Marc RegasFashionNewsThe Pirelli Calendar casts its first ever plus-size modelTake a peek at the new behind-the-scenes images from next year's calendar, featuring plus-size model Candice HuffineShareLink copied ✔️July 30, 2014FashionNewsTextZing Tsjeng There's a lot that the Pirelli Calendar has done over its 50-year history – photographed Miranda Kerr topless with a sloth, created gold penis-plates and used up about a year's worth of bodypaint (probably) on a single shot – but they've never cast a plus-size model. For their 2015 fetish-themed calendar, they're looking to rectify that oversight with Candice Huffine, a Maryland native signed to Muse. If Huffine looks familiar, that's because she's previously been shot in Vogue Italia's groundbreaking Curvy issue in 2011. Huffine graces the pages of next year's Pirelli Calendar alongside Adriana Lima, Joan Smalls and Karen Elson, which was photographed by Steven Meisel and styled by former French Vogue editor Carine Roitfeld. Take a look at what's in store with these behind-the-scenes images, shot by Marc Regas. The full calendar will be revealed in November.
